The Ingredients: A Symphony of Flavors

The success of Middle Eastern cuisine lies in its use of a wide range of ingredients, each contributing to the rich and complex flavors of the dishes. Some key ingredients found in Petra’s menu include:

1. Herbs and Spices

Herbs and spices are the backbone of Middle Eastern cuisine, adding depth and complexity to dishes. Common herbs include parsley, mint, and cilantro, while spices such as cumin, coriander, and turmeric are used to create aromatic and flavorful dishes.

2. Legumes

Legumes such as chickpeas, lentils, and beans are a staple in Middle Eastern cuisine, providing a source of protein and fiber. These ingredients are used in dishes such as hummus, falafel, and kushari.

3. Grains

Grains such as bulgur wheat, rice, and semolina are used in a variety of dishes, from salads to desserts. These grains provide a base for many Middle Eastern dishes and are often used in combination with other ingredients to create a balanced flavor profile.

4. Fruits and Vegetables

Fruits and vegetables are abundant in Middle Eastern cuisine, providing a fresh and healthy element to dishes. Common fruits include dates, figs, and pomegranates, while vegetables such as eggplant, tomatoes, and cucumbers are used in a variety of ways.

The Cultural Significance of Middle Eastern Cuisine

Middle Eastern cuisine is not just a collection of dishes; it is a reflection of the region’s rich cultural heritage. The culinary traditions of the Middle East have been shaped by a variety of factors, including geography, religion, and history. Here are some key aspects of the cultural significance of Middle Eastern cuisine:

1. Food as a Social Gathering

In the Middle East, food is a central part of social life. Meals are often shared with family and friends, and communal dining is a common practice. This emphasis on food as a social gathering is reflected in the menu at Petra’s Middle Eastern Cuisine, with dishes designed to be shared among diners.

2. Religious Influences

Religion has played a significant role in shaping Middle Eastern cuisine. For example, Muslims follow dietary laws that prohibit the consumption of pork and alcohol, which has influenced the types of ingredients and dishes that are common in Middle Eastern cuisine.

3. Historical Influences

The Middle East has been a melting pot of cultures throughout history, and this has had a profound impact on the region’s cuisine. Influences from neighboring countries, such as Turkey, Iran, and Egypt, can be seen in the variety of dishes and ingredients used in Middle Eastern cuisine.
